sql设置周数开始

时间:2015-09-04 08:53:15

标签: sql date week-number

此声明为我提供了从current week

开始的1st of january的编号
select datepart(week,getdate())

我希望从1st november开始计算。
有没有办法可以做到这一点?
我知道第一种方法可以选择一周开始的那天等。

1 个答案:

答案 0 :(得分:0)

您可能正在寻找DateDiff

select DATEDIFF(week, '1-Nov-2014', GETDATE()) + 1
OutPut: 45